yes, Olympiakos is gonna be out of champions league. But hope they can go to uefa cup. also what is the meaning of the logo of olympiakos? does that guy in the picture has any meaning in greek or for the club? is he a greek-god? also what is the meaning of the words around the head?
yes,the guy is supposed to be a winner of an ancient olympic game(that is why he is wearing a laurel-wreath on his head).As for the words:Ολυμπιακος(=Olympic)-Συνδεσμος(=association)-Φιλαθλων(=fans)-Πειραιως(=Piraeus) The club was established in 1925(in Piraeus),by a group of fans who decided that the club's name should signify the olympic values in which they believed.
